Israel-Palestine-Jordan
IDF warns Hezbollah is bringing Israel to the brink of a ‘wider escalation'
2024-06-17
[IsraelTimes] As cross-border attacks escalate, army spokesman Daniel Hagari says ‘one way or another we will ensure the safe return of Israelis to their homes — that is not up for negotiation’

CBS News reported that US officials were also increasingly concerned that an all-out war could break out after eight months of skirmishes, since Hezbollah began attacking Israel in October in support of the Hamas terror group in Gaza.

In light of the US concerns, the Axios news site reported Friday that Amos Hochstein, a senior adviser to US President Joe Biden, will arrive in Israel on Monday to try to put a lid on the escalation.

Hagari said Hezbollah “has been escalating its attacks against Israel. Since deciding to join the war that Hamas started on October 7th, Hezbollah has fired over 5,000 rockets, anti-tank missiles, and explosive UAVs from Lebanon at Israeli families, homes, and communities.”

He said it was “jeopardizing the future of Lebanon so that it can be a shield for Hamas. A shield for the Hamas terrorists who murdered the elderly, raped women, burned children, and kidnapped Jews, Muslims, and Christians, during their massacre on October 7th.”

“When we say that we will not let October 7th happen again on any one of our borders, we mean it,” Hagari added.

Noting Hezbollah’s “refusal to comply with UN Security Council Resolution 1701,” which ended the Second Lebanon War and mandated that the terror group withdraw north of the Litani River, Hagari said that “because of Hezbollah’s military infrastructure, weapons and fire at Israel from the area south of the Litani River in southern Lebanon, and because of Lebanon’s failure to enforce 1701 on Hezbollah, Israel will take the necessary measures to protect its civilians, until security along our border with Lebanon is restored.”

The skirmishes on the border have resulted in 10 civilian deaths on the Israeli side, as well as the deaths of 15 IDF soldiers and reservists. There have also been several attacks from Syria, without any injuries.

Hezbollah has named 342 members who have been killed by Israel during the ongoing skirmishes, mostly in Lebanon but some also in Syria. In Lebanon, another 63 operatives from other terror groups, a Lebanese soldier, and dozens of civilians have been killed.
